Afghan president calls on armed oppositions to give up resistance
font size    

Afghan President Hamid Karzai Saturday called on armed militants to give up resistance and resume their normal life in the country.

"Today once again I am calling on those who play at the hands of Afghanistan's enemies and damage their country to give up militancy and resume normal life at home as a good citizen," President Karzai announced on the 15th anniversary of Afghan Mujahidin ( holy warriors) victory in 1992.

President Karzai stressed that peace in Afghanistan would benefit the whole region and called on neighboring states to help ensure durable peace in the post-Taliban central Asian state.

Fighting terrorism requires serious and honest cooperation of all the regional countries, the Afghan leader emphasized.
